Leamouth Peninsula offers a distinctive character that balances peaceful waterside surroundings with excellent connectivity to the city. The riverside location provides a welcome sense of space and tranquillity, whilst the nearby creative quarter of Trinity Buoy Wharf with its lighthouse and arts spaces adds cultural interest to the neighbourhood. The area's ongoing development continues to enhance local amenities, whilst the Thames Path offers scenic routes for morning jogs or evening strolls along the water.
Canning Town station sits 0.7 miles away, delivering excellent transport connections via the Jubilee line, DLR and Elizabeth line. This convergence of services provides swift access to Canary Wharf, the West End, the City, and Stratford, whilst Heathrow Airport becomes readily accessible for frequent travellers. The Thames Clipper service offers an alternative scenic commute along the river.

Rent is payable on a monthly basis and you may be required to pay more than a month's rent in advance, depending on your circumstances. You will be required to pay a 1 week holding deposit following a successful offer. Utility bills, council tax, telephone line and broadband are not included in the rent. Tenancies with annual rents up to £50,000 will require a 5 weeks' security deposit, while those exceeding this threshold will require a 6 weeks' deposit. Utility bills, council tax, telephone line and broadband are not included in the rent.
